University president continues capitulation to Israeli pressure

The student protest camp for Gaza at Columbia has been assaulted several times by police

Columbia University in New York will not divest its investments in Israeli firms and firms that supply weaponry to Israel, according to the university’s president Minouche Shafik, despite demands from thousands of its students who are protesting in solidarity with the Palestinian people and against Israel’s genocide. Shafik, echoing the narrative of Israel lobbyists, has even claimed that the protests have made the university unsafe for Jewish students, even though Jewish students and faculty members are playing a leading role in the protests, as if the feelings of some students, who don’t like to be confronted with the reality that a country they support is engaged in genocide, are more important than stopping mass murder of women and children.

The announcement continues Shafik’s shame after she failed to challenge a narrative spouted by pro-Israel lawmakers during her questioning by politicians – and claimed a pro-Palestine professor at the university had been sacked and would never teach at Columbia again, a claim denied by Professor Mohamed Abdou.

Columbia is one of a string of universities across the US that have shamed themselves by calling in armed police to arrest and disperse protests against the genocide in Gaza. Some, parroting the pro-Israel lobby, have even accused the students of ‘siding with terrorists’.
